Q: How many buildings are there this year, in the 2026 competition, that I can apply to?
A: This year applications can be submitted for three buildings, the Haus der Weimarer Republik, Schillers Wohnhaus and the Niketempel.
Q: For how many buildings can I apply?
A: You can choose as many as you want.
Q: What needs to be considered in the production of the competition video, how do I proceed?
A: You produce one 30-second 2D video clip (in 4K resolution) for each building that you apply for. Download the animation pack and look at the mask (filename "Mask_Contours") of the respective building. It clearly shows the actual playable areas of the building. Unfortunately, animations outside this area cannot be mapped.

Q: What are the most important aspects I should consider when creating the competition video?
A: The building should be thematically themed to match the inherent spirit, the 'genius loci' - i.e. the history of the building, what it could have been, how it appears based on its architecture, perhaps also inspired by its surroundings or function. Creativity is required! The building's facade serves as a backdrop for a thoughtful narrative. Professional knowledge of video mapping techniques is not a must, much more important is a convincing artistic concept, a gripping dramaturgy and a successful image and sound design.
Q: How do I submit my 30-second video?
A: Register on our website and fill in all the required information. Please submit your video online for download (e.g. via Vimeo, WeTransfer…). On the registration page, in the "Add Project" section, there is a URL mask where you can paste the download link. Remember to tell us your password if one is needed! For the public presentation and the public vote we will upload all submitted videos to Vimeo.
Q: In the Animation Packs you can find 3D models in various formats that I can't open. Also, I don't know how to work with 3D.
A: You can neglect the 3D models for the production of the contest video, and submit a pure 2D animation. Just make sure that your 2D video matches the respective building mask (filename "Mask_Contours") from the Animation Pack. It gives you the actual playable building surface.
Q: I downloaded the Animation Pack, but there is no specified camera position in the 3D model. From which perspective should the clip be rendered?
A: The details of the render perspective are described in the document "_START_HERE_ReadMe", which you can also find in the Animation Pack:
„Please render your animation in a front view with a parallel perspective without a vanishing point. The projection surface should be in the middle of the image. To achieve that, please refer to the .pdf or the .png with the name «facade contours» for aligning your animation."

Q: If a building has two facades, such as Schiller's Residence, should the proposal include the entire building (both facades) or be limited to one of the two facades?
A: Yes. If a building has more than one facade in the template, your projection proposal should include all shown surfaces. Please also follow the masking contours (Mask_Contours) provided in the Animationpack.
Q: There is a Tree in front of the Building that I want to apply for. Will the project be developed around the trees surrounding the buildings, or will the trees be removed?
A: We work with multiple projectors to fully illuminate the building surfaces. There may be a few small shadows caused by leaves, but these are usually barely noticeable, so you do not need to consider the trees in your design. If there is any important obstacle affecting the projection area, we will always clearly mention it in the production process.

Q: Are live shows allowed? For example with a dance performance or live music?
A: It is hard to answer this question in general. Basically yes, but please note the following:
- Is the budget sufficient for the realization?
- Does it work with our time cycle of 15 minutes? It is important to consider that, for example, dancers or singers have to be available for three evenings, every 15 minutes, in any weather, to accompany the performance.
- How can the idea be best expressed with the given means (project text and video clip)?
Q: Which codec should I use for the 30 second clip?
A: H.264 with ALAC audio. The resolution should be 4K 3840x2160.

Q: How does my 2D video appear on the 3D facade?
A: During the festival, the film will then be projected onto the building using media servers and several projectors.
Q: Is there on-site support for the technical implementation?
A: Yes, we can help with the technical implementatiom and projection on site. You produce a video clip and we organize the projection.
Q: Is the technical equipment for the projection provided? And is a sound system also available?
A: Yes, the technical equipment is provided. A sound system is also available.
Q: Which mapping software will be used at the festival?
A: The MXWendler FXServer software is used. Contest participants can request a software version for laptops with which they can simulate the projection.
